Job Title: Document Controller



Vacancy Overview:

Are you looking for a career which is rewarding, at the cutting edge of project development and where you can really make a difference? Come and join our expanding team and work on one of the most exciting and largest megaprojects in the UK, whilst being at the forefront of the UK's climate change agenda and energy policy. Following on from the success of our site , the Project is a nuclear new build project in Suffolk, which has obtained planning approval and Government financing support. The project has started construction and is now seeking private investment. When completed, it will provide dependable electricity to 6 million homes for 60 years, which along with renewables, will support Britain to achieve Net Zero by 2050.

Job Purpose / Overview:
The purpose of the role is to ensure effective document control within our site, following designated procedures and contributing to continuous improvement.

Principal Accountabilities:
* Provide a professional, accurate and reliable administration support service to the DMT Department.
* Develop core document management skills on a large-scale capital programmes, supporting Senior Document Controller and Lead Document Controller and in the management and maintenance of documentation, data and records within the EDRMS
* Manage, capture, control, store, and disseminate all relevant current and historical documentation within

* Log and quality assure incoming and outgoing documents and communications, producing and issuing transmittals to provide an auditable trail for all documentation
* Support the integration of NNB's document management system with its wider information management needs
* Comply with approved processes and procedures
* Champion best practice Document Management within their team
* Maintain a focus on continuous improvement in Document Management Team's performance, processes, and procedures
* Produce and interpret management reports on performance
* Study latest industry developments and best practice in the document control space
* Represent the Document Management Team in meetings

Knowledge, Skills, Qualifications, Experience

Desirable:
* Document Control experience in a complex stakeholder environment * Experience of working in a project environment, delivering against set objectives and milestones
* Understanding of the quality assurance process applicable to document control
* Strong awareness of effective record keeping
* Knowledge of filing systems and the aim of distribution matrices
* Awareness of the importance of document, data, and/or information management in a large-scale capital project
* A good understanding of the functions of Electronic Document and Record Management Systems
* Strong competence in the use of the Microsoft Office Suite
* Ability to influence and promote the overall role that Document Management fills on a project and the importance of successfully managing interfaces

Qualifications & Experience:
No formal qualifications are required as long as there is an ability to demonstrate a good standard of general education
